Join Zion and Jasiah as the discuss the issues of equity, race, and exploitation in medicine. After reading "The Immortal Life of Henrietta Lacks" by Rebecca Skloot, they are exploring how race and power have shaped ethical decision-making in medical research and how these inequities have been addressed today.
